Sesame seeds: Decline in imports

NEW DELHI. Imports to Germany have dropped by as much as 38% since 2016. India has, in addition, won most of the bids for the South Korean tender.

 

India to supply 8,800 mt

Suppliers in India have, as expected, won most of the bids for the tender from South Korea. Only as little as 1,100 mt will by supplied from other origins such as Pakistan and Vietnam. The original tender was issued for 10,000 mt.

Rain impacts prices

The high rainfall in Gujarat caused the sesame prices to drop this week and enhanced demand. Traders are hoping for an increase in acreage and ideal growing conditions for the main crop to compensate for the small summer crop.
